(B-2) Filling developer unit with developer material

(1)

Install the developer nozzle jig on the devel-

oper bottle.

(2)

Rotate the gear on the rear side of the devel-

oper unit to the direction of the arrow while

filling the developer unit with the developer

material. Spread out the developer material

over the developer sleeve.

Note:

When installing the upper cover of developer unit,

attach the latches securely.
